环信推送如何实现用户反馈收集?
随着移动互联网的快速发展,用户对于应用的使用体验要求越来越高。为了提升用户体验,收集用户反馈成为企业运营中不可或缺的一环。环信推送作为一款功能强大的即时通讯工具,如何实现用户反馈收集,成为了许多开发者关注的焦点。本文将详细解析环信推送在用户反馈收集方面的实现方法。
一、环信推送简介
环信推送是环信即时通讯云平台提供的一款功能丰富的推送服务,支持Android、iOS、Windows等多种平台。它可以帮助开发者实现消息推送、用户在线状态监控、离线消息存储等功能。在用户反馈收集方面,环信推送可以借助其强大的推送能力,将用户反馈信息实时推送至开发者服务器,从而实现快速响应和优化。
二、环信推送用户反馈收集实现方法
- 创建用户反馈表单
首先,开发者需要在应用中创建一个用户反馈表单,该表单应包含以下内容:
(1)用户信息:包括用户名、联系方式等,便于开发者后续联系用户。
(2)反馈内容:用户反馈的具体问题或建议。
(3)反馈时间:记录用户提交反馈的时间,便于开发者分析用户反馈趋势。
(4)反馈等级:根据用户反馈的严重程度,分为普通、重要、紧急等等级。
(5)反馈渠道:记录用户通过何种渠道提交反馈,如应用内反馈、微信公众号等。
- 获取用户反馈信息
当用户在应用中提交反馈时,环信推送可以将用户填写的信息实时推送至开发者服务器。具体实现步骤如下:
(1)在用户提交反馈时,将用户信息、反馈内容、反馈时间、反馈等级、反馈渠道等数据封装成一个JSON格式的字符串。
(2)使用环信推送的API,将JSON字符串发送至开发者服务器。
(3)在开发者服务器端,解析接收到的JSON字符串,并将数据存储到数据库中。
- 分析用户反馈数据
收集到用户反馈数据后,开发者可以借助数据分析工具对用户反馈进行分类、统计和分析,以便了解用户需求,优化产品功能。以下是一些常见的分析方法:
(1)按反馈等级统计:了解用户反馈的严重程度,针对紧急反馈及时响应。
(2)按反馈渠道统计:分析用户反馈的来源,优化反馈收集渠道。
(3)按反馈内容分类:了解用户关注的重点问题,针对性地进行产品优化。
(4)按时间趋势分析:观察用户反馈随时间的变化,预测用户需求。
- 优化产品功能
根据用户反馈数据,开发者可以针对性地优化产品功能,提升用户体验。以下是一些优化方向:
(1)修复已知问题:针对用户反馈的问题,及时修复bug,提高产品稳定性。
(2)改进功能设计:根据用户反馈,优化产品功能,提升用户体验。
(3)增加新功能:根据用户需求,开发新的功能,满足用户需求。
(4)优化用户体验:从用户反馈中寻找改进点,提升产品易用性。
三、总结
环信推送在用户反馈收集方面具有强大的功能,可以帮助开发者实时收集用户反馈,分析用户需求,优化产品功能。通过以上方法,开发者可以充分利用环信推送的优势,提升用户体验,增强用户粘性。在实际应用中,开发者应根据自身需求,灵活运用环信推送,实现高效的用户反馈收集。
猜你喜欢:IM小程序